On the prime spectrum of the p-adic integer polynomial ring with a depiction
Abstract
In 1966, David Mumford created a drawing of Proj Z [X,Y] in his book, "Lectures on Curves on an Algebraic Surface". In following, he created a photo of a so-called 'arithmetic surface' Spec Z [T]for his 1988 book, "The Red Book of Varieties and Schemes". The depiction presents the structure of Spec Z [T] as being interesting and pleasant and is a well-known picture in algebraic geometry. Taking inspiration from Mumford, we create a drawing similar to Spec Zp [T], which has a lot of similarities with Spec Z [T].
